It looks like the issue is that when uploading there was some connection issue with these particular games and 0 bytes of data were transferred. A bug in the server mistakenly took these games and passed them to the next player. The server should have rejected them and forced them to re-uplaod. We have fixed it so that this issue will not happen in future (when the patch comes out). However unfortunately there is no way to recover the games where this has happened
I understand this is very frustrating for you guys but it was not an issue that ever came up before. I don't know why it has started happening since Rise of Rome released but it is possibly due to the high levels of traffic as RoR has been extremely popular.
